Our barge arched anti‑collision plates are fully manufactured in our own factory, integrally stamped from complete marine steel sheets. Without segmented welding joints, the plates maintain stable and reliable mechanical performance.
Barges are exposed to frequent collisions during daily operation, mainly from tug pushing and berthing against adjacent vessels. Ordinary bare deck plates are prone to permanent denting and cracking after repeated heavy impact. Weld this arched wear‑resistant plate onto high‑stress deck zones. Its curved profile efficiently spreads impact energy and safeguards the original base deck structure, which greatly reduces vessel maintenance frequency and repair costs.
Every product is finished with professional marine anti‑corrosive paint to cope with corrosive inland water and coastal environments.
